NATURAL RIGHTS THROUGH THE YEARS ON ‘MTSU ON THE RECORD’
MTSU’s Dr. Bill Levine Reviews Legal Scholar’s Tome on American Principles

(MURFREESBORO) – Dr. William Levine, MTSU English professor, will recap his presentation at the Liberty Fund Socratic Seminar last month in Indianapolis on ‘MTSU on the Record’ with host Gina Logue at 7 a.m. this Sunday, April 26, on WMOT-FM (89.5 and wmot.org).
Levine applied his expertise in 18th century literature to an analysis of Restoring the Lost Constitution by Randy E. Barnett. The author asserts that American Constitutional rights as seen through the prism of natural rights have eroded over the years through judicial misinterpretation.
